4-bed family house on 689mยฒ | 35-year-old build with 175mยฒ internal | solid rental yield near 4% | established suburban setting with school catchments
This is a competitively strong family house for Craigmore, offering four bedrooms and two bathrooms on a 689mยฒ allotment with 175mยฒ of internal living space. The 1991 build is now well-established, and the combination of ducted air conditioning, built-in robes, floorboards, and a shed makes it suited to families seeking a move-in-ready home with room to grow. The property sits in a street dominated by detached houses, which reinforces the suburban family character, and the rental yield signal around 4% suggests consistent demand from tenants as well as owner-occupiers. First-home buyers and upgraders are the most likely buyer groups, as the configuration and condition align with what those segments typically seek in this outer-northern Adelaide suburb.
The age of the build may mean some systems or finishes require attention within the next few years, which could affect the price a buyer is willing to offer. The land size is standard for the area, so no scarcity premium applies, and the absence of a premium view or walkable urban amenity means the value is driven primarily by the house itself and its suburban setting. School catchment proximity to Blakeview Primary School and Craigmore High School may support demand from families, but this should be verified directly with the education department. The lack of recent comparable sales in the available data means a buyer should confirm market evidence before forming a final view on price.

Market Insight:
Craigmore is a family-oriented suburb with a stable, established demographic, where demand is primarily driven by owner-occupiers, particularly families. This has supported robust recent price growth and a competitive sales environment with properties transacting efficiently. Future performance will be influenced by continued household income growth, though a high proportion of mortgaged owners indicates sensitivity to economic conditions.
